Day 46 : Battlesbridge to Whitstable (103.1 miles)

Day 46 complete – 103.1 miles, 1160m climbing. Matt left Battlesbridge at 8.45 and cycled to Ashingdon, Westcliff-on-Sea, South Benfleet, Dunton Wayletts, Upminster …

then down to Woolwich where he caught the ferry across the Thames which took about 10 mins and was free.

He then cycled along the Thames path to Erith, through Dartford, past Gravesend and down to Rochester, through Chatham, Upchurch, Howt Green, Bapchild, Faversham, past Graveney, Seasalter and on to Primrose Cottage campsite at Whitstable.

Took about 7 hrs today as the traffic was really bad and the road surfaces awful in places but it was dry with cloud and some sun and not too windy.
